The area to be credited to the 75-250’ zone for hardcover calculation purposes <br />is 1,970 s.f.,yieIdingatotal 75-250'area ofll,160 s.f. for calculation purposes. The <br />resultant hardcover allowance of 25% would therefore be 2,790 s.f., the equivalent <br />of an allowance of 30.36% hardcover in the 75-250' zone. <br />The City Council has considered this application including the findings and <br />recommendations of the Planning Commission, reports by City staff, comments by <br />the applicant and the public, and the effect of the proposed variance on the health, <br />safety and welfare of the community. <br />The City Council finds that the conditions existing on this property are peculiar to it <br />and do not apply generally to other property in this zoning district; that granting the <br />variance would not adversely affect traffic conditions, light, air nor pose a fire hazard <br />or other danger to neighboring property; would not merely serve as a convenience to <br />the applicant, but is necessary to alleviate a demonstrable hardship or difficulty; is <br />necessary to preserve a substantial property right of the applicant; and would be in <br />keeping with the spirit and intent of the Zoning Code and Comprehensive Plan of the <br />City. <br />CONCLUSIONS, ORDER AND CONDITIONS <br />Based upon one or more of the above findings, the Orono City Council hereby grants <br />a variance to Orono Municipal Zoning Code Section 10.24 Subdivision 5B to allow construction of <br />a new residence to replace a pre-existing residence on the property containing 0.47 acres in area in <br />the LR-1 n Zoning District where a 1.0 acre minimum lot area is required; and a variance to Sections <br />10.22 Subd. 2 and 10.56 Subd. 16(LK 1 &2) to allow 274 s.f (2.47%) hardcover in the 0-75' lakeshore <br />zone where no hardcover is normally allowed, and to allow 2,790 s.f (30.36%) hardcover in the 75- <br />250' lakeshore zone where only 25% hardcover is normally allowed; and a variance to Sections 10.5 5 <br />Subd. 8 and 10.56 Subd. 16(J)(2) to allow grading and filling within 75’ of the OHWL of Lake <br />Miimetonka where no grading and filling is normally allowed; and a variance to Section 10.56 Subd. <br />16(J)(5) to allow filling within a bluff impact zone where no placing of fill is normally allowed <br />subject to the following conditions: <br />Page 3 of 6
